Transaction 6ae96fe2f90fbf603da51c4fb3397d69fbb2159c85a18402b7e9feba18d1f43b

1 Input
2 Outputs
  • 6ae96fe2f90fbf603da51c4fb3397d69fbb2159c85a18402b7e9feba18d1f43b:0
  • value  22515717
    address  3K92QRgn5BnEGg3WBD5r1g3Zp666Qmenkp
  • 6ae96fe2f90fbf603da51c4fb3397d69fbb2159c85a18402b7e9feba18d1f43b:1
  • value  3450650
    address  1EJiYuSXW9UdGxWaxChiPk4wE8rPn5WYem